Who are Mechanical Contractors & How Do They Contribute to the Economy?

According to the Mechanical Contractors Association of America, mechanical contracting companies are responsible for installation, alteration, and repair of plumbing, piping, heating, cooling and refrigeration systems in buildings and structures. A mechanical contractor is licensed and skilled to handle anything involving mechanical parts.

The fact that we owe modern amenities like regulated temperatures, clean breathing air, sanitary surroundings and effective drainage to mechanical contractors is something that most people are aware of. But these workers also save millions of dollars every year by performing their jobs well and ensuring that the units which define our modern life and productivity function optimally.

HVAC systems that aren’t installed or repaired properly lose their efficiency. They consume more energy to maintain a given output and increasing the demand for electricity. It may seem like a trivial issue when considered in the context of one residence. But imagine the same happening for thousands of homes and large industrial sites and the implications become clear.

The US loses billions of gallons of potable water every year because of poor sanitary systems and infrastructure. Money is squandered when defective drains allow moisture to seep through and adversely impact roofs and foundations of structures making collapses more likely.

A lot rests on the shoulders of mechanical contractors who apply their knowledge to enhance the longevity and proper utilization of valuable economic assets.

Who are Industrial Contractors & Where do They Figure?

Industrial contractors oversee key tasks within the industrial sector. They manage workers, guide mechanical contractors, supervise construction and demolition and budget projects.

They are not only responsible for keeping construction assignments on time and within estimated costs, they also determine the success of mechanical contractors to some extent. Since the selection, priming and support of these individuals are the domain of industrial contractors, their preparation and know-how is always reflected in the performance of their mechanical counterparts.
